The Rise of SpaceX: From Risk to Revolution
When Elon Musk launched SpaceX, many experts dismissed the idea as impossible. Building rockets privately? Competing with NASA? It sounded like science fiction. But Musk’s determination changed everything.
- In 2008, SpaceX became the first private company to launch a rocket into orbit.
- By 2012, it sent a spacecraft to the International Space Station (ISS).
- Today, SpaceX dominates the commercial space sector with contracts from NASA, private corporations, and governments worldwide.
The turning point was the creation of reusable rockets, slashing the cost of space travel by up to 70%. What once cost billions now costs millions, opening space to commercial opportunities like never before.
How SpaceX Makes Billions: Business Model Uncovered
Most people think SpaceX is just about sending rockets into space. But the company has developed a diverse, high-value business model that generates billions in revenue each year.
- Commercial Satellite Launches – Global companies pay SpaceX to launch satellites, with each launch costing anywhere between $60 million to $100 million.
- NASA Contracts – NASA pays SpaceX for cargo and astronaut transport to the ISS, saving billions in taxpayer money.
- Starlink Internet – One of SpaceX’s most profitable ventures, Starlink aims to provide high-speed internet worldwide, reaching billions of potential customers.
- Defense Contracts – The U.S. Department of Defense relies on SpaceX for national security satellite launches.
- Tourism & Future Colonization – With plans for space tourism and Mars colonization, SpaceX is tapping into trillion-dollar future industries.
This combination of government contracts, commercial partnerships, and consumer services makes SpaceX a cash-generating machine with high growth potential.
